Starting Point and First Stops: Eze and La Turbie

Your day begins with a pickup from the Cannes cruise port, where your guide greets you in a private, air-conditioned minivan ready for a full day. The first highlight is Eze, a medieval village perched high above the sea. As one of the most photographed spots on the Riviera, Eze offers dramatic views, cobbled streets, and exotic gardens. You’ll visit the Fragonard perfumery—a favorite for those curious about perfume-making—where the secrets of fragrance creation are unveiled, and you can enjoy some free samples. Next, you’ll pass through La Turbie, known as the “Terrace of Monaco” for its panoramic views of the Principality. The Roman Trophy of the Alps, built in 7 BC, is a highlight here. From this vantage point, you’ll get a sweeping glimpse of Monaco’s skyline, the sea, and the surrounding mountains. Monaco: Glamour and Grandeur

Your guide then takes you into Monaco, often called “The Rock” for its dramatic location. You’ll see the Prince’s Palace, the Oceanographic Museum, and the Cathedral—where Grace Kelly married Prince Rainier. Saint-Paul-de-Vence: Art, Charm, and Atmosphere

On your way back toward Cannes, you’ll stop at Saint-Paul-de-Vence, a medieval hilltop village renowned for its art studios and quaint streets. Entering through the Royal Gates, the narrow streets are lined with galleries, cafes, and shops—each home seemingly a work of art. End in Cannes: The Glamorous City

The final stop is Cannes, famous for its annual film festival and glamorous promenade, the Croisette. Here, you’ll see the Palais des Festivals, the setting for the world’s most famous film awards. The city’s bay offers stunning views, framed by mountains and with the Lerensk islands dotting the waters.

You’ll also pass by iconic hotels like the Carlton, and many travelers appreciate the blend of seaside luxury with vibrant street life. It’s a fitting end to a day filled with beauty, glitz, and culture.
